IO-AI Tech, founded in Shenzhen, China in 2023, develops end-to-end data infrastructure for real-world robotics and embodied AI. The company's proprietary integrated hardware and software stack covers robot teleoperation, data collection, annotation, visualization, quality assurance, and model-ready export. Key products include TeleXperience, a general robotic teleoperation platform supporting 60+ robot configurations including humanoids, robot arms, and dexterous hands, and EmbodiFlow, an embodied AI data platform that creates a continuous robotics data flywheel.
IO-AI operates globally with offices in Shenzhen, Osaka, Singapore, Sydney, and the San Francisco Bay Area.
